set number set relativenumber set tabstop=4 set softtabstop=4 set shiftwidth=4 set expandtab set smartindent set wrap set noswapfile set nobackup set backupdir=~/.vim/undodir set undofile set hlsearch set incsearch " set termguicolors set scrolloff=8 set signcolumn=yes set isfname+=@-@ set updatetime=50 set colorcolumn=80 let mapleader=" " nnoremap :Ex vnoremap J :m '>+1gv=gv vnoremap K :m '<-2gv=gv nnoremap zz nnoremap zz nnoremap n nzzzv nnoremap N Nzzzv nnoremap gs :Git call plug#begin() Plug 'junegunn/fzf', { 'do': { -> fzf#install() } } Plug 'junegunn/fzf.vim' Plug 'tpope/vim-commentary' Plug 'arcticicestudio/nord-vim' Plug 'itchyny/lightline.vim' call plug#end() set termguicolors colorscheme nord nnoremap pv :Ex nnoremap :so ~/.vimrc nnoremap :GFiles nnoremap pf :Files nnoremap :cnext nnoremap :cprex set belloff=all set guifont=Menlo:h20 let g:lightline = { \ 'colorscheme': 'nord', \ } set laststatus=2 set wildmenu set wildoptions=pum